Air Fryer Fajitas
These air fryer fajitas are a quick, fun and family-friendly twist on a classic. We’ve chosen breaded chicken nuggets for this recipe to speed up the prep and cooking time. The nuggets are also seasoned and coated in breadcrumbs so you don’t need extra oil, marinades or cheese to add flavour and crunch.

We recommend pairing the nuggets with plenty of peppers, onions and a little bit of lettuce to provide a boost of vitamins, antioxidants and fibre. You can always prep your veggies ahead of time and store them in the freezer for up to 3 months.
What you'll need:
1 red pepper
1 yellow pepper
1 medium white onion
1 tablespoon of olive oil
1 teaspoon smoked paprika
½ teaspoon chilli powder or mild fajita seasoning
Salt and pepper to taste
Iceberg lettuce
4-6 soft tortillas
Method:
- Place your chicken nuggets in the air fryer and cook at 180°C for 10-12 minutes
- While the chicken nuggets cook, slice the peppers and onion and toss in a bowl with the olive oil. Add the spices and salt and pepper and mix until everything’s evenly coated.
- Add the seasoned veg to the air fryer and cook at 180°C for 8-10 minutes, shaking once, until soft and lightly charred.
- While the veg cooks in the air fryer you can wash and chop the lettuce and set aside.
- Slice the cooked chicken nuggets. Warm the tortillas in a microwave. Fill each tortilla with veggies, chicken and lettuce.
- Roll up and enjoy while everything is warm and crispy.
